Installation location of the pressure gauge on the deaerator

2009-03-05View Original

Thread Content

Boiler water is deoxygenated using steam thermal deoxidation; the steam is introduced at the bottom of the deoxidizer’s packing. The deoxidizer must be maintained at a slight positive pressure. So, where are your pressure measurement points located? At the upper part of the filler cylinder? Or the center? The lower part again?

On our unit, there is a vent pipe at the top of the deaerator; the measurement points are installed in that upper area, which prevents the pressure from reflecting the actual pressure inside the boiler, resulting in unstable steam addition.

The pressure gauge of a thermal deaerator is usually located on the deaeration head.

Two points should be installed: one at the deaeration head to measure the inlet steam pressure, and another in the middle to measure the pressure of the deaerated water
